
The average Federal Bureau of Investigation Senior Designer earns an estimated $137,939 annually, which includes an estimated base salary of $117,406 with a $20,533 bonus. Federal Bureau of Investigation's Senior Designer compensation is $24,958 more than the US average for a Senior Designer. Senior Designer salaries at Federal Bureau of Investigation can range from $58,000 - $293,455.
